With a clear vision of the future as a digital society, and as developments in technology continue to rise at unprecedented speed, it’s understandable how brands look … WebMercado (1974: 6) had identified the Filipinos’ concept of “loob” in two-fold. First, “loob” is holistic, secondly, “loob” is interior. The holistic concept centered on the unified entity of the world. The Filipino’s view of the …
